What Does a a Renters Insurance Agent in Tuscaloosa Cost?
Renters insurance in Alabama typically costs between 15 and 30 dollars per month for standard coverage. In Tuscaloosa premiums may be slightly higher due to tornado and severe weather risk. Factors like the amount of personal property coverage your deductible and your credit history affect the final price. This is general information not insurance advice.
About renters insurance agents in Tuscaloosa
Renters insurance agents in Tuscaloosa Alabama help tenants protect their personal property and liability. Alabama law does not require renters insurance but many landlords in Tuscaloosa do require it in the lease. An agent can explain how coverage works for tornado damage or theft near the University of Alabama campus.
Frequently Asked Questions
What does a renters insurance agent in Tuscaloosa do?
A renters insurance agent helps you find a policy that covers your belongings and liability. They explain Alabama-specific risks like severe storms and can help you file a claim after a loss. Agents also advise on how much coverage you need based on your lease and valuables.
Is renters insurance required by law in Alabama?
No Alabama law does not require renters insurance. However many Tuscaloosa landlords and property managers include a requirement for renters insurance in the lease agreement. Your agent can help you meet that requirement and ensure you are properly covered.
